-
java – 如何使用在thenCombineAsync中返回CompletionStage的方
所属栏目:[Java] 日期:2020-12-15 热度:178
我有3个返回CompletionStage的函数.让我们说它们看起来像: CompletionStage 现在我想编写返回CompletionStage 的fuction funcD.结果由funcC计算,params来自funcA和funcB.现在的问题是如何正确地做到这一点? 我阅读文档后的尝试看起来像这样,但我不确定它是[详细]
-
java – 如何创建一个接受文件名并可以打印其内容的类?
所属栏目:[Java] 日期:2020-12-15 热度:135
我在编写一个可以从文件中读取和打印的类时遇到问题.看起来传递给构造函数的文件名实际上并没有分配给fileName变量,或者我可能在File和Scanner对象上做错了.我真的不知道什么是错的或如何解决它.我是初学者,只是在班上使用文件,所以我可能会遗漏一些明显的东[详细]
-
Java接口应该只包含getter吗?
所属栏目:[Java] 日期:2020-12-15 热度:200
我有一些关于界面使用的一般问题: 为每个对象类创建接口有什么好处? 接口应该只包含getter方法吗? 为什么不也是二传手呢? 为什么我要为每个对象类创建一个接口?它会在JUnit测试中为我服务吗? 例如 : public interface Animal { public getVoice(); pu[详细]
-
java程序监视目录
所属栏目:[Java] 日期:2020-12-15 热度:98
嘿家伙我想创建一个程序,24/7监视一个目录,如果一个新文件添加到它,那么如果文件大于10mb,它应该排序.我已经实现了我的目录的代码,但我不知道如何在每次添加新记录时检查目录,因为它必须以连续的方式发生. import java.io.*;import java.util.Date;public cl[详细]
-
spark – 如何减少JavaPairRDD的shuffle大小?
所属栏目:[Java] 日期:2020-12-15 热度:199
我有一个JavaPairRDD 我想在其上执行groupByKey操作. groupByKey动作给了我一个: org.apache.spark.shuffle.MetadataFetchFailedException: Missing an output location for shuffle 如果我没有弄错的话,这实际上是一个OutOfMemory错误.这只发生在大数据集[详细]
-
java – 如何以最快的方式交叉两个排序的数组?
所属栏目:[Java] 日期:2020-12-15 热度:74
我有两个巨大的排序数组(每个~100K项).我需要非常快地交叉它们.现在我以标准的方式做到这一点: 如果a [i] 如果a [i]> b [j]然后j 否则:将一个[i]添加到交集,i,j 但是完成时间太长(~350微秒),导致整体性能相当差.有没有办法更快地做到这一点? 附:交叉口大[详细]
-
java – Thread.sleep和之前发生的关系是什么?
所属栏目:[Java] 日期:2020-12-15 热度:114
我写了一个简单的应用程序,它有主线程(生产者)和多个消费者线程.我想从主线程广播一条消息,所以所有的消费者线程都会收到它. 但是,我有麻烦. 我试图了解Thread.sleep如何与Happens-Before相关.这是我的一段代码: import java.util.*;public class PubSub {[详细]
-
java – 为什么Tomcat 8.5重新加载上下文
所属栏目:[Java] 日期:2020-12-15 热度:82
似乎自从我们将tomcat升级到版本8后,我们就会在启动时获得上下文重新加载.然而,它似乎只发生在我们的开发环境中(带有eclipse和tomcat 8.5的Windows操作系统).我们的生产环境(带有tomcat 8.5的linux OS)没有这个问题.我发布在下面,但我没有看到任何迹象表明为[详细]
-
如何在java中使用sparkSubmit更改hdfs中的用户
所属栏目:[Java] 日期:2020-12-15 热度:104
我想更改hdfs中使用的用户与jvm中使用的用户相比,因为我有这个错误: Stream spark: org.apache.hadoop.security.AccessControlException: Permission denied: user=www,access=WRITE, node=/user/www/.sparkStaging/application_1460635834146_0012:hdfs:hd[详细]
-
使用java.util.function.Function实现Factory Design Pattern
所属栏目:[Java] 日期:2020-12-15 热度:140
使用java.util.function.Function实现Factory Design Pattern是否正确 在下面的示例中,我使用Function引用来实例化Person类型对象. import java.util.function.Function;public class Main { public static void main(String[] args) { Function 最佳答案 工[详细]
-
java – 为什么oracle存储过程的执行时间会大大增加,具体取决于
所属栏目:[Java] 日期:2020-12-15 热度:121
这是我的问题: 我们有一个名为:HEAVY_SP的存储过程,在所有场景中都使用相同的参数 我们有一个oracle sql开发人员.这可以称为:IDE 根据执行方式,执行时间大大增加: (1)直接在查询窗口(IDE)中调用HEAVY_SP(0,F,5,)= 15秒(我们当前的解决方案) (2)使用IDE的[详细]
-
java – 线程无法停止
所属栏目:[Java] 日期:2020-12-15 热度:123
为什么我的线程无法停止??? class Threadz { class runP implements Runnable { int num; private volatile boolean exit = false; Thread t; public runP() { t = new Thread(this,"T1"); t.start(); } @Override public void run() { while(!exit) { Syste[详细]
-
java中的Matrix类
所属栏目:[Java] 日期:2020-12-15 热度:50
我需要帮助在java中创建一个Matrix类,所以我发布了stackoverflow.最终我明白了.由于我无法删除此问题,因此我决定将完成的Matrix Class放在网上.如果你要从中获取一些东西,试着把它变成你自己的. import java.util.Scanner;public class Matrix{//State Varia[详细]
-
java – RMI Server不会使用LocateRegistry.createRegistry方
所属栏目:[Java] 日期:2020-12-15 热度:98
我现在使用的是LocateRegistry.createRegistry(1099)而不是在外部进程中使用注册表.但是,在主程序结束后,注册表将会死亡.例如,如果我创建一个创建注册表的简单程序,它将无法工作,因为在main executino之后代码结束.我期待LocateRegistry代码创建一个线程,但[详细]
-
找不到请求操作的编解码器:[date
所属栏目:[Java] 日期:2020-12-15 热度:173
在Cassandra中,列类型设置为Date,而在Model类中,字段类型设置为带有getter和setter的java.util.Date.在com.datastax.driver.mapping.Mapper.save期间,我得到以下异常: Codec not found for requested operation: [date 在Google搜索期间找到以下内容: DATE[详细]
-
验证Azure AD令牌签名失败JAVA
所属栏目:[Java] 日期:2020-12-15 热度:70
我正在努力验证Azure AD令牌签名. 当我在“jwks_uri”字段下查找正确的密钥描述时 https://login.microsoftonline.com/common/.well-known/openid-configuration 我检查所属的密钥数据. 我尝试使用“n” 模数和“e”字段来生成签名验证的公钥我最终得到一个[详细]
-
Java类编译时错误“无法访问接口”
所属栏目:[Java] 日期:2020-12-15 热度:152
我有一个接口存储有两个方法getName()和getAddres(),我有一个实现商店的类Market 这是我的代码: public interface Stores { public String getName(); public String getAddress();} 具体课程: public class Market implements Stores { private String na[详细]
-
java – LibGDX截图奇怪的行为
所属栏目:[Java] 日期:2020-12-15 热度:89
我遇到了一个在LibGDX中截取我的桌面应用程序的相当奇怪的行为.我重新制作了一个小程序来重现这个“bug”,它只渲染黑色背景和红色矩形.那些图像是结果: 左边是来自窗口屏幕剪辑工具的屏幕截图,这就像运行程序一样.右边是我发布的屏幕截图代码.为了澄清,我希[详细]
-
java – 使用DataSource连接到带有(Xerial)sqlite-jdbc驱动程序
所属栏目:[Java] 日期:2020-12-15 热度:194
Java Tutorial表示有两种方法可以通过JDBC连接到数据库:使用DriverManager类(旧的,不推荐使用)和使用DataSource类. 我不知道如何使用DriverManager做到这一点: Connection con = DriverManager.getConnection("jdbc:sqlite:mytest.db");... 但我找不到如何[详细]
-
使用java的REST API AWS云
所属栏目:[Java] 日期:2020-12-15 热度:147
我是AWS的新手,想要开发一个云就绪的Java应用程序REST API. 应用程序将访问MySQL数据库并在查询数据库后生成输出为JSON. IP:端口/应用程序q =查询响应是JSON. 怎么实现呢? MySQL中的数据主要是静态的100MB数据,但经常使用. 最佳答案 这是非常直截了当的.如[详细]
-
java – Google Cloud Platform:无法从Container Engine访问P
所属栏目:[Java] 日期:2020-12-15 热度:163
我正在尝试从运行在Google容器引擎中的Scala应用程序(即在Kubernetes中运行)发布到现有的pubsub主题. 我已启用(我认为)底层群集的正确权限: 但是,当我尝试运行我的Scala应用程序时,出现以下错误: 2016-12-10T22:22:57.811982246Z Caused by:com.google.clo[详细]
-
有没有办法为Java的Charset名称添加别名
所属栏目:[Java] 日期:2020-12-15 热度:173
我得到一个异常,埋没在第三方库中,有这样的消息: java.io.UnsupportedEncodingException: BIG-5 我认为这是因为Java没有为java.nio.charset.Charset定义这个名称. Charset.forName(“big5”)很好,但Charset.forName(“big-5”)抛出异常. (所有这些名称似乎[详细]
-
java – 在maven构建中的Aspectj坏版本号警告
所属栏目:[Java] 日期:2020-12-15 热度:105
我在maven构建期间收到警告,我想修复. maven构建期间生成的警告: [INFO] aspectj-maven-plugin:1.4:compile (default) @ core [WARNING] bad version number found in C:UsersDR25687.m2repositoryorgaspectjaspectjrt1.7.1aspectjrt-1.7.1.jar exp[详细]
-
java – jars是否应该“提供”依赖项?
所属栏目:[Java] 日期:2020-12-15 热度:189
我们正在构建一个将在Websphere上运行的耳朵,其中提供了j2ee.jar. 现在我们的情况是ejb(称为ejb.jar)依赖于另一个jar(称为util.jar),它依赖于j2ee.jar. 如果将util.jar的pom中的j2ee.jar标记为“提供”,则ejb.jar将不会生成,因为提供的不是传递的.如果我们将[详细]
-
java – 如何使用RowMatrix.columnSimilarities的输出
所属栏目:[Java] 日期:2020-12-15 热度:134
我需要计算一行的列之间的相似性,并尝试使用columnsimilarities()方法来获得结果. public static void main(String[] args) { SparkConf sparkConf = new SparkConf().setAppName("CollarberativeFilter").setMaster("local"); JavaSparkContext sc = new Ja[详细]
- java – 无法在类class org.apache.log4j.core.l
- 单元测试 – 如何在JUnit测试中避免多个断言?
- java – Lambda Metafactory变量捕获
- java – 如何禁用Eclipse(3.3.2)警告:访问封闭
- java – 为什么我们实现Cloneable,即使我们可以
- Java网络游戏:如何列出可用的服务器?
- java.util.concurrent.ExecutionException:java
- java – JDBC连接/结果集/语句的最佳实践是什么
- java.lang.ExceptionInInitializerError异常的解
- 如何在java中监视可用内存(包括缓存和缓存)?